What to expect in the role

Collaborate with assigned customer stakeholders including but not limited to JPM GNOC, WTS team and New Era CSC to perform the following on site services: 

  1. IT Infrastructure Hardware (HW): 
    • Checking and troubleshooting 
    • Installation and decommissioning covering an incident 
    • Network patching of servers, switches, routers, and modems 
    • Network cable/ports checking and troubleshooting 
    • Remote Hands support as directed by JPMC
  2. Site survey
    • This service includes any and all undertakings required to collect and transmit the necessary information regarding network, server and storage devices within the Data Center. This includes the completion of an information checklist (to be provided by JPMC point of contact), taking necessary digital photographs, and transmitting completed site survey to JPMC team.
  3. Carrier Circuit Demarcation Extension
    • This service includes any and all tools, materials and labor to install up to a 150 foot demark extension. This includes either 4xCat6 or 2xCoax (DS3) cable extensions.
  4. Telecom Circuit Test and Turn-up Support
    • This service includes the test and turn-ups of circuits. Supplier technician will dial into pre-established conference bridge with JPMC contacts and carrier provider and add / remove loops for testing with the MER/TR/Colo as needed. Supplier’s technician will provide console access to data network device(s) and troubleshooting support as required by JPMC contact and carrier(s). 
    • This service does NOT include circuit extension from the demarcation point.
  5. Device Install/Decommission 
    • Includes the installation, and/or hot swap, de-installation of multiple devices all capable of being physically racked by a single technician (including routers, switches, modem, CSU’s, server and storage equipment). This task includes any, and all tools (including a digital camera), console cables, materials, equipment and time necessary to perform work. Service may include disconnect / reconnect / troubleshooting of devices. Service also includes all patching needs, initial configurations and asset tagging / labelling. 
    • This service includes taking digital photographs before and after work is completed. Pictures should include, but not be limited to patch panels, network equipment (including close ups of cabling and connections), rack views and room views. 
    • Supplier must complete a QA checklist and provide photograph(s) to JPMC team via a JPMC approved transmission methodology
  6. General Network Support
  7. Break/Fix
    • In coordination with JPMC team, respond to and address break / fix tickets for network, server and storage devices within MERs/TR/Colo. This task includes any and all tools including a digital camera, console cables, materials, equipment and time necessary to perform work. This includes calling in to a bridge or direct with the other JPMC teams
  8. Tape/Media Handling Disposal
    • The scope of services is all media (storage unit, tape, HDDs, etc.) handling within MERs/TR/Colo including, but not limited to: media backup and replication, media installation, media decommission / destruction, and media transport
    • This service includes oversight of 3rd party specialist destruction of any storage or tape units, but not performance of the actual destruction activity itself
    • This service includes taking digital photographs before and after work is completed. Supplier must complete a QA checklist and provide photograph(s) to JPMC via approved transmission methodology
  9. Logistics
    • This service is to coordinate shipping and receiving of equipment for install / decomm at a given MER/TR/Colo. This includes interfacing with JPMC and 3rd party shipper to verify shipment and receipt of MER equipment, tape, and media in support of services above
  10. Risk Assessment
    • This service includes any and all undertakings required to collect and transmit the necessary information regarding MER risks including access control, video surveillance, alarms, fire suppression, HVAC, temperature / humidity, asset tagging, tape / media presence, power, UPS, cabinet locks, etc. This includes the completion of risk assessment form (to be provided by JPMC point of contact), taking necessary digital photographs, and transmitting completed risk assessments to JPMC team.
  11. Patching
    • Installing/Removing an Ethernet/fiber patch cable to linking a computer to a nearby network hub, switch, router.
  12. Vendor Management
    • Provide a technician to attend a non-badged OEM & other Vendors who require access into STS JPMC spaces based on approved JPMC Ticket
  13. Surveys
    • This service includes all undertakings required to collect and transmit the necessary information regarding user & network information. This includes the completion of an information checklist (to be provided by JPMC Point of Contact), taking necessary digital photographs, and transmitting completed site survey to JPMC team
